well the formula to reflecting across the x-axis is (x,-y).so the final points are A'(2,-2) B'(3,-7) C(5,-5) ANSWER
additional information
By the way the -y in the formula does not mean every number will always be negative it means switch the sign so if the point is (5,-7) than reflecting across the x-axis it would be (5,7)
